Once upon a time, there was a fluffy cat at home. And she wanted her personal house. Today I'll tell you how anyone can make it :)
You need:
- a small piece of linen cloth
- synthetic padding
- two small cuts of plywood 8 mm thickness
- corrugated cardboard
- paper tubes of different diameter
- jute cord
- PVA glue
- corners
- bolts and screws
Cut out the bases and make 18 sticks:
Make marks, drill them through and pull the fabric over. Insert the sticks:
Put on the second base and start twining the sticks with the jute cord:
The top 'nest' has just been made.
Now proceed to the 'ground floor'.
Cut out a larger base, it's out of plywood. Attach three cylinders:
I glued the plywood blank with a soft artificial grass — kitties liked it :)
The two shorter cylinders are twisted with jute cord also, they'll be the pillars holding the 'nest'.
Make a cut — it'll be the third pillar of the 'nest'.
Fasten a plywood shelf at the top:
And wrap the pillars with the jute twine:
Voila! :)
